Applications
2-(4-Morpholino)thiobenzothiazole (CAS 102-77-2) is a synthetic intermediate and specialty additive with multiple industrial applications. It is commonly used as a vulcanization accelerator and/or antioxidant in rubber and elastomer cure systems; serves as a building block for morpholine-containing compounds used in p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als; acts as a precursor for benzothiazole-based colorants in coatings and inks; used in polymer chemistry as a monomer builder or functional crosslinking agent; and functions as a specialty additive for coatings and metal-protection formulations.
